** Job Summary
** Reporting to the Senior Vice President and Chief Development Officer, CHOC Foundation, the Associate Vice President, Data Intelligence serves as a key member of the Foundation Leadership Team and is responsible for advancing the Foundation's data intelligence strategy, analytics capabilities, and operational infrastructure. This role leads the organization's data ecosystem to transform data into actionable intelligence that drives fundraising performance, donor engagement, operational excellence, and organizational growth.
The AVP oversees enterprise data governance, business intelligence, fundraising analytics, reporting, and technology platforms that support development operations. This position is responsible for ensuring the accuracy, integrity, accessibility, and strategic utilization of fundraising and donor data across the organization. Through advanced analytics, predictive modeling, performance measurement, and actionable insights, the AVP enables data-driven fundraising strategies and supports sustainable organizational growth.
In addition, the AVP provides oversight of development operations functions including gift administration, prospect development and fundraising technology systems while ensuring alignment with organizational objectives and industry best practices.
